Abstract
Let us consider two vector fields (1) X' = F(X) (2) Y' = F(Y) defined on a give Euclidean space E where F and G are of class CN+1. Furthermore, assume that there is a smooth compact manifold M smoothly imbedded in E and that M is invariant for both vector fields. Also that F and G agree on M, i.e. F|M = G|M. We wish to study the question of CS-conjugacies between (1) and (2).
